Output 43709f4b77b6d793120c89a84e8981896ab054a02941ae5c61104c668a877fea:0

value
128312327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d48f3bed3566d060239c8d2c48c00d6d1a08587 OP_EQUAL
address
3LQTqfvTYqvJwd3kJnWUPhiW6tv84yApaW
transaction
43709f4b77b6d793120c89a84e8981896ab054a02941ae5c61104c668a877fea
spent
true